Output d375760243bca93c120bc858e3957578a49a59818d41fc4ec8114f105c832d4f:1

value
20598461
script pubkey
OP_0 OP_PUSHBYTES_20 1c045d6de8e08e1824e7a91d9370f480fa1b1f37
address
bc1qrsz96m0guz8psf884ywexu85srapk8eh7vl7l4
transaction
d375760243bca93c120bc858e3957578a49a59818d41fc4ec8114f105c832d4f
spent
true